WebNov 30, 2016 · The patella is firmly invested within the quadriceps tendon, and belongs to the extensor mechanism, which also includes the quadriceps tendon, medial and lateral retinacula, patella, and patellar tendon. The extensor mechanism is responsible for the extension of the knee and the ability to maintain an erect position. WebApr 10, 2024 · MRI. Sagittal T1. Bone contusion of the medial aspect of the patella and the lateral femoral condyle with an osteochondral defect of the medial patellar facet. Moderate joint effusion is noted. The medial patellar retinaculum is thickened with abnormal intrinsic high signal but no evidence of disruption is seen. WebApr 10, 2024 · Typical bone marrow edema pattern of transient lateral dislocation of the patella, which occurs on a background of mild trochlear dysplasia / patellofemoral instability. Calcific prepatellar bursitis or housemaid's knee is a chronic condition characterised by dystrophic calcifications in a chronic inflamed prepatellar bursa, which is a thin synovial lined superficial bursa anterior and slightly inferior to the patella. Due to repetitive kneeling pressure trauma. Scleroderma could also cause this. Crossref, Medline, Google Scholar WebPatella in medial oblique view Position of patient Prone position. Position of part Flex the patient’s knee about 5-10 degrees. Medially rotate the knee 45-55 degrees from the prone position. Central ray Perpendicular to the IR, exiting the palpated patella. Collimate closely to the patellar area. Mild lateral patellar subluxation is present as indicated by the off-midline positioning of the patellar tendon (arrowhead). 3 Figure 3: WebNov 30, 2016 · The patella acts as a fulcrum for a mechanical advantage. In fact, without a patella, more force would be required to achieve knee extension [6]. Imaging modalities Evaluation and classification of patellar fractures is based on anteroposterior (AP), lateral, and skyline view radiographs of the knee.

WebA patella alta, or high-riding patella, is a patella that is too high above the trochlear fossa and occurs when the patellar tendon is too long. Patella alta has been associated with recurrent dislocations, and about 25% of the patients with acute patellar dislocation have a …

A bone bruise occurs anterior to this site of impaction as the patella reduces with knee extension. Medial patellar chondral injuries may occur during either the dislocation or reduction phases of injury. ost beta tester scam
